FlixBus is one of Europe's leading low-cost coach operators, founded in Germany and offering long-distance coach services in Europe and the U. S. FlixBus also operates overnight coaches on select routes throughout Europe. Standard amenities on FlixBus include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ge your phone, tablet or laptop during long coach journeys, extra legroom, luggage space and toilets. You can even purchase snacks and drinks onboard. FlixBus offers only the Standard ticket for all its routes, which allows you to bring one hand luggage and one hold luggage per person.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and specific seat reservations, such as if you want to book an Extra Seat, Table Seat or the Panorama Seat.
Tallinn to Helsinki coach information with FlixBus:
When departing from Tallinn, you have various coach station options to start your trip from including Tallinn, Bussijaam and Tallinn, Passenger Port (D-Terminal). When arriving in Helsinki, you can end your trip in coach stations like Helsinki, linja-autoasema, Helsinki, Länsiterminaali 2 and Vantaa, Helsinki airport (Terminal 2).
Passengers board the coach most frequently from Tallinn, Bussijaam, which is located around 1.4 miles (2.2 km) away from the city centre, and they get off the coach at Helsinki, linja-autoasema, located 0.4 miles (678 m) away from the city centre.
